Pinochle![]() ![]() Source: The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 Penuchle \Pe"nu*chle\, Pinocle \Pin"o*cle\ Pinochle \Pin"o*chle\, n. A game at cards, played with forty-eight cards, being all the cards above the eight spots in two packs.
